Oregon unemployment tax rates to drop


Tax rates employers pay for unemployment insurance will fall in 2014 for the first time in three years.

The average tax rate drops from 3 percent to 2.76 percent, the state said. Officials say the lower rates could save employers $85 per employee, on average, and more than $100 million overall.

“The reason the rates are down is because the unemployment insurance trust fund is at a healthier level,” employment department spokesman Craig Spivey. “We’ve been at the highest tax level for the last three years.”
